| Re: Windows Server 2008 Beta 3 Richard G. Harper wrote:[color=blue] > Old news, and not topical to this newsgroup. >[/color] Not old news as far as I know. There has been, however, considerable confusion about the naming of the various betas. Build 6001 (available in April 2007), for example, is labeled beta 3, but is actually beta 2. Microsoft states that the latest beta, which has just become publicly available, is proposed to be that final beta before what I assume may be one or more release candidates; i.e., RC1, RC2, etc. More details are at: [url]https://www.microsoft.com/servers/faces/default.aspx[/url] Regarding server versus desktop, there are many users who utilize "server" versions for either desktop or combined desktop and server applications. One of the multiple reasons for doing this with Windows Server 2008 is that the software is further in the future in the production cycle, there is a different team of Microsoft engineers working on at least some of the aspects of Server and some of Vista's many problems have been corrected. Server 2008 is available for test and evaluation at minimal cost until April 2009. It isn't an unreasonable choice to try it until then and possibly switch to Vista for desktop only applications at that time if Microsoft has improved that operating system. I don't know of a single report from a user who has tried Server build 6001, has not liked it and has not found it to be vastly superior to Vista. This is in contrast to the seemingly endless complaints and problems with Vista. We have, however, now had some problems with beta 3 and had to go back to beta 2 which, since April 2007, hasn't had a single operating system crash and has run all of our standard application programs without any problems. NaturallySpeaking 9.5, which works flawlessly on build 6001, crashes immediately on execution with a "privileged instruction" error. A second problem is that beta 3 doesn't include the Radeon 7000 series video adapter driver that is in beta 2. This is a big problem for us because there is no known alternate source for this driver. (As opposed to software considerations, video adapters on server hardware platforms can be a real problem). I should say that the installation was an upgrade rather than a clean install. The is a legitimate option, but I am well aware that it is always best to do a clean install. It does, however, take about eight hours to install the operating system and all the application programs. The only good news is that the test computer is always backed up using an Ez Bus DTS SATA drive hardware and a complete restore took only about 18 minutes. I might try NaturallySpeaking 9.5 on a clean installation of Server Beta 3, but perhaps someone else has already done this and knows if the program will work on this version of the beta. |
